Abstract

Recent trend of integrating ICT in engineering solutions has enabled superior engineering capabilities to create high-value-added products and services which lead to the disruption and transformation of traditional engineering industries. This chapter firstly highlights the ICT-driven industrial evolution to demonstrate the importance of ICT for building engineering capabilities in the international context. The typical ICT-enabled advanced manufacturing technologies and models are then introduced, which represent the most advanced engineering, manufacturing and management capabilities in the current business environment. By reviewing the ongoing ICT revolution, this chapter suggests high value engineering strategies for the major economies of the world and indicates the value creating dominance of ICT for engineering sectors in the future.
